Torsion Spring Replacement
Torsion springs are the heavy lifters on most Roswell two-car garages, and they’re also the most dangerous component we handle. In Roswell’s 30076 communities, the original springs installed during the subdivision boom were rated for roughly 10,000 cycles — about 7–10 years of normal use. Those springs are now 25–35 years old. A typical spring repair in Roswell runs $180–$340. We match wire size, inner diameter, and wind direction precisely; mismatched springs chew through cables and strip drums fast. Because of the stored tension involved, we never recommend homeowners attempt this themselves. Extension Spring Replacement
Extension springs run parallel to the horizontal tracks and are more common on older single-car garages and some pre-1960 homes near Canton Street. They’re under extreme tension when extended and require safety cables to contain a broken spring. In Roswell, we see fewer extension springs than torsion systems, but when they fail on a historic-character property, matching the hardware discreetly matters. We stock standard sizes and can source same-day for most installations.

Rollers & Hinges
Noisy, shuddering doors in Roswell often trace to cracked nylon rollers or worn hinge barrels. Roller replacement runs $110–$220 depending on count and whether you’re upgrading to sealed steel ball-bearing rollers for quieter operation. That’s a genuine concern in dense 30076 subdivisions where garage doors open at 6 a.m. and neighbors notice. We carry standard 2-inch and 3-inch rollers plus quiet-rated options that reduce decibel levels significantly — worth considering if your bedroom sits above or adjacent to the garage.
Weatherstripping & Bottom Seal
Roswell’s periodic winter ice events — freezing rain, not heavy snow — create a specific failure mode: bottom seals freeze to concrete slabs overnight, and the morning opener pull tears already-fatigued springs or rips the seal from its retainer. We install heavy-duty EPDM rubber seals with flexible cold-weather compounds that resist hardening and slab adhesion. For north-facing garages in shaded sections of Horseshoe Bend or near the Chattahoochee, we also recommend brush-style or dual-fin seals that handle humidity-driven expansion better than basic vinyl.
